Comprehending Macaws
Before diving into Where To Buy Macaws to purchase macaws, it is important to comprehend these stunning creatures. Macaws come from the parrot household, mostly discovered in Central and South America. They are known for their long tails, powerful beaks, and amazing intelligence. Macaws can weigh anywhere from 2 to 4 pounds and can live for several decades, that makes them a long-lasting dedication for any owner.

Where to Buy Macaws
When looking to purchase a macaw, there are numerous opportunities to explore. Each source has its pros and cons, and prospective buyers should consider their specific circumstances and requirements before making a choice.
1. Trustworthy Breeders
Getting macaws from a reliable breeder is often considered the finest technique for acquiring a healthy and well-socialized pet.
Benefits:
- Breeders are most likely to provide in-depth health records, evidence of family tree, and details about the bird's habits.
- Buyers can often observe the birds in a social environment and choose one that matches their temperament choices.
Downsides:
- Reputable breeders may charge higher prices, with costs generally varying from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 3,000 depending upon the species.
- Accessibility can often be limited, as breeding macaws is a precise and lengthy procedure.
2. Pet Stores
Regional pet stores can be another alternative for acquiring macaws, although this path has significant considerations.
Benefits:
- Pet stores might have several macaws on display, allowing possible owners to see the birds up close.
- Immediate ownership is possible, with no waiting duration for a breeder to raise the bird.
Drawbacks:
- Birds sold in pet stores may not feature a documented health history or socializing record.
- Some shops may focus on earnings over the well-being of the animals, leading to ethical issues.
3. Rescue Organizations and Sanctuaries
Adopting a macaw from a rescue organization or sanctuary not only conserves a bird's life but also uses a possibility to give a second possibility to a formerly overlooked or abused pet.
Advantages:
- Adoption costs are typically lower than purchase prices from breeders or shops, and numerous saves provide initial health checks and required vaccinations.
- Saved birds are often spayed/neutered and might include some behavioral training.
Disadvantages:
- Potential owners may have limited options regarding species and age.
- Some saved birds might come with behavioral concerns needing extra training and care.
4. Online Marketplaces
Some possible owners might consider purchasing macaws through online platforms.
Benefits:
- A large range of options may be offered, often with competitive pricing.
- Buyers can reach out to sellers across the country or perhaps worldwide.
Drawbacks:
- The danger of scams and health issues is significant; animals might be misrepresented.
- Buyers can not physically examine the bird before purchase, causing potentially bad choices.

FAQs About Buying Macaws
1. Just how much does it cost to buy a macaw?
The cost of a macaw differs considerably based on the species, age, and whether it is bought from a breeder, pet store, or rescue organization. Prices normally vary from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 3,000.
2. What should I consider before buying a catalina macaw price?
Prospective owners must think about several factors, including:
- The size of their living area and its suitability for a big bird.
- Their ability to offer stimulation and friendship for an intelligent parrot.
- The time and resources readily available for care, training, and interaction.
3. Are macaws good pets for families?
While numerous macaws can be affectionate and caring, they require considerable time and social interaction, making them preferable for families with older children who comprehend how to communicate with birds correctly.
4. What should I feed my macaw?
A balanced diet plan for a macaw must consist of high-quality pellets, fresh fruits, veggies, and occasional nuts. Owners must seek advice from avian vets for individualized dietary guidance.
5. What is the lifespan of a macaw?
Macaws can have long life-spans, often living 30 to 50 years or more when properly cared for.
